The contract entails the removal of logs, brush, and rubbish from spillway riser inlets, shorelines, and dam crests at Dutchman Lake and Frank’s Tract, with all debris requiring offsite disposal. Work must be performed in accordance with environmental and safety standards to ensure the integrity and functionality of the water control structures. The project is designated as a Small Business Set Aside under the SBA program, restricting eligibility to qualifying small businesses, and is classified under NAICS code 562991 for other waste management services. Performance is localized to Harrisburg, Illinois, with a zip code of 62946, and is managed by the U.S. Department of Agriculture through its CSA East 6 office. The solicitation was posted on July 31, 2026, with bids due by August 12, 2026, at 8:00 p.m. Eastern Time. This is a subcontract opportunity, meaning the winning contractor may be engaged by a prime contractor to carry out specified tasks under a larger agreement. While no point of contact is listed, interested parties can access additional details via the provided SAM.gov link. All work must be completed within the contractual timeframe, and compliance with federal regulations regarding waste handling and disposal is mandatory.

C26950004 - Chino Hills SP - Septic Pumping Service Contract
Solicitation # 0000039936
The contractor is required to provide up to 30 septic pumping services annually for the California Department of Parks and Recreation at Chino Hills State Park, with services centered around emptying 4,000-gallon and 1,500-gallon sewage vaults as outlined in DPR 326B and Exhibit B, Attachment I. All waste must be transported and disposed of at approved offsite facilities, and work must be completed within 72 hours of a service request, ensuring cleanliness, safety, and readiness for use. The contractor is responsible for supplying their own equipment, with listed equipment serving only as bidding guidance. The contract period runs from October 1, 2026, through September 30, 2029, or 36 months after DGS-OLS approval, whichever is later. Bids must be submitted by August 21, 2026, via email in PDF format to IEDContracts@parks.ca.gov with a specified subject line, or as sealed paper copies mailed to the Inland Empire District office in Perris, California. Questions regarding the bid package must be submitted by August 11, 2026, and answers will be distributed via addendum, which bidders are responsible for monitoring and downloading. While the DVBE participation requirement has been waived, a 1% to 5% incentive credit is still applied based on DVBE involvement, and a 5% preference reduction is granted to certified small businesses for award evaluation. The award will be based on the lowest responsive bid after adjustments for these incentives, using a low-price technically acceptable approach without formal trade-offs. All submissions must include complete documentation including the bid form, site map, budget details, special terms, AI disclosure form, and compliance certifications. No pricing has been filled in the bid form, leaving the contract value unspecified. Payment must be invoiced within 90 days of contract termination and include the agreement number, service date, and itemized cost. The contractor must comply with California state certifications including drug-free workplace, nondiscrimination, and AI disclosure requirements, and must disclose any subcontractors and their certifications if applicable. There are no specified FOB terms, key personnel requirements, contract options, or security clearances, and no formal inspection locations are defined, though final acceptance remains the responsibility of the state.

McConnell AFB 2026 Air Show Latrines and Hand Washing Stations
Solicitation # FA462126Q0030
The 2026 Airshow at McConnell Air Force Base requires a full-service contract for portable sanitation and handwashing facilities, encompassing 159 standard portable restrooms, 21 ADA-compliant units, and 18 hand washing stations, with an optional addition of 20 more portable units. The contractor must deliver, install, service, and remove all units in strict alignment with the timeline: setup completion by 4:00 PM on October 22, 2026, and full removal by 4:30 PM on October 26, 2026. Servicing must occur over three calendar days during the event window, including daily pumping, scrubbing, restocking of supplies, waste disposal, debris removal, and emergency response support during operational hours. All equipment must arrive undamaged, pest-free, and fully functional, with compliance to Air Force Instruction 32-7086, federal and Kansas environmental regulations, and base security protocols including DBIDS and REAL ID verification for personnel access. The solicitation, identified as FA462126Q0030, is a Small Business Set-Aside under NAICS code 562991 with a $9 million size standard, and is structured as a Firm Fixed Price contract under the Lowest Price Technically Acceptable evaluation method. All proposals must be submitted as a single PDF no longer than five pages, including a fully completed SF 1449 with pricing in the bid schedule, and representations certified either directly on the solicitation or via SAM.gov. Offers must remain valid through October 31, 2026. The contract incorporates numerous FAR/DFARS clauses related to labor standards, equal opportunity, trafficking in persons, paid sick leave, cyber security, Buy American, and prohibitions on procurement from Xinjiang and the Maduro regime. Safety Data Sheets for all chemicals used are mandatory, and contractor personnel must adhere to base access rules, including vehicle searches and ID verification. Payments will be processed electronically via Wide Area WorkFlow, and the Government retains the right to reject non-compliant offers without negotiation. The performance location is Building 412 at McConnell AFB, Kansas, with inspection and acceptance occurring upon delivery at that site.
